  1. Feeling Famished? Follow the List Below and Satiate your Hunger Mark that- whenever you are around St. Kilda, don’t miss the chance to explore the best and brightest cafes in its neighborhood. The vibrant St. Kilda is more than a suburb and has a lot of joints that serve some of the tastiest delicacies. Be it a vegan or a coffee-lover, this suburb has cafes of all sort. An interesting fact about this suburb is that people from other corners of Melbourne, come to experience the exoticness of the cafes here. So, if you are also planning to visit this suburb anytime soon, here is the list of café in St Kilda. Staple Providore - This café is known for staying connected to the roots by keeping the basics intact. Staple goes by its name and serves the classic brunch staples- eggs, bacon, potato hash, crumpets along with everyone’s dearest bacon and egg butty. Two Birds One Stone Café- Known for the French décor, aromatic coffees, and the fluffiest pancakes, this cafe serves you the best menu. Their menu is formulated with vegan as well regular dishes, which makes them the favorite of many. Also, the cozy environment that they offer is perfect for your morning reads. Matcha Mylkbar- This is a plant-based café, exclusively built for vegans, serving the dishes with a twist. Their very famous vegan egg is something you must try. The yolk part of the dish is made of sweet potato, coconut milk, linseed protein, and its white part is made of a mix of coconut and almond milk. Hannah- Mostly proclaimed as the cool kid of St. Kilda, this café has the most astonishing ambiance which takes you back to retro days. The menu served here has a twist that most of the visitors praise. We bet, once you visit this café, you would be hooked with them and visit them again. Miss Jackson- People of Melbourne are fond of having delectable dishes in every meal they eat. And this café right here, serves just that, for instance- Texan brisket and crispy pork belly. Moreover, this cafe is located at a place where there is the least rush that enables you to enjoy your meal in solace, with taste in every bite. The St. Kilda Dispensary- Built at the place of Sothern Hemisphere’s biggest dispensary, this café is known to serve you with a lot of history on side of every dish they offer. And the new version of this dispensary-turned-café has a gourmet menu that includes ham toasties to roasted chicken.
